Job description

Welder A Advanced

Altrad are currently looking for experienced Welders to join the team for Mtce Works.

This role will involve working 38 Hours ( Monday - Friday) OT As and When required

Mobilisation Start Date ASAP

The position is paid Inline with NAECI agreement ( National Guaranteed Rates) - £20.91 p/h, with lodge and travel paid where applicable.

Key Deliverables
  • Carry out welding activities on safety-critical components and high-integrity pipework in accordance with approved welding procedures and specifications.
  • Read and interpret engineering drawings, welding procedures, isometric drawings and contract specifications to determine work requirements.
  • Prepare materials, welding consumables and equipment prior to commencing welding activities, ensuring all safety requirements are met.
  • Assemble and set up welding equipment using approved procedures and safe working practices.
  • Perform TIG, MMA and FCAW welding processes on a variety of materials and pipework systems.
  • Weld large bore and small bore pipework to the required quality, dimensional and technical standards.
  • Inspect weld preparations and completed weld joints using approved inspection methods.
  • Identify welding defects, variations and non-conformances and take corrective action where required.
  • Support the inspection of weld joints produced by pipefitters and other fabrication personnel.
  • Complete quality documentation and support final visual and volumetric testing activities.
  • Work in accordance with permits to work, risk assessments, method statements, POWRA requirements and site safety procedures.
  • Store and manage welding consumables, equipment and materials in accordance with company procedures.
  • Reinstate equipment and work areas to a safe condition following completion of welding activities.
  • Support continuous improvement initiatives by identifying and reporting issues, defects and opportunities for improvement.
  • Provide guidance and support to Welding Trainees where required.
  • Maintain the highest standards of safety, quality and workmanship at all times.
  • Communicate effectively with supervisors, chargehands, engineers, clients, subcontractors and regulatory representatives.
Key Requirements / Qualifications
  • General secondary education or equivalent.
  • Completed a recognised Welding Apprenticeship or equivalent vocational qualification.
  • NVQ Level 3 in Welding, ACE Card or equivalent industry-recognised certification.
  • Current welding qualifications to ISO 9606, ASME IX or equivalent standards relevant to the project requirements.
  • Valid CCNSG Safety Passport or equivalent site-required safety certification.
  • IOSH Managing Safely certification is desirable.
  • Minimum two years' experience as a production welder within an industrial environment.
  • Demonstrable experience welding high-integrity pipework and safety-critical components.
  • Proficient in TIG, MMA and FCAW welding processes.
  • Experience welding large bore and small bore pipework across a range of materials.
  • Experience within the oil & gas, petrochemical, thermal power generation or nuclear sectors is desirable.
  • Understanding of human performance principles and safe working practices.
  • Ability to read and interpret welding specifications, engineering drawings and technical documentation.
  • Critical task training and site-specific authorisations as required by the project.
  • Strong commitment to safety, quality and continuous improvement.
